2021-12-20 CVE-2021-44224 NULL Pointer Dereference vulnerability in multiple products
A crafted URI sent to httpd configured as a forward proxy (ProxyRequests on) can cause a crash (NULL pointer dereference) or, for configurations mixing forward and reverse proxy declarations, can allow for requests to be directed to a declared Unix Domain Socket endpoint (Server Side Request Forgery).

2021-12-20 CVE-2021-44790 Out-of-bounds Write vulnerability in multiple products
A carefully crafted request body can cause a buffer overflow in the mod_lua multipart parser (r:parsebody() called from Lua scripts).
